Transaction e6c37432e3577a8bb7caaeea2ba93096ef93d54975f9694116e0463f01ea0810

3 Input
2 Outputs
  • e6c37432e3577a8bb7caaeea2ba93096ef93d54975f9694116e0463f01ea0810:0
  • value  657566
    address  3KKPcJYRkXLVC8GiMY5NuHJh9p1eaJrSiz
  • e6c37432e3577a8bb7caaeea2ba93096ef93d54975f9694116e0463f01ea0810:1
  • value  851120
    address  3BMEXu18eu6Z5LsUcmLFDp5vYy8LnAfFnh